pycharm pip install安装drf
时间: 2023-09-21 11:09:15 浏览: 120
要在PyCharm中使用pip安装drf(Django REST Framework),请按照以下步骤进行操作:
1. 打开PyCharm并打开你的项目。
2. 在PyCharm的底部工具栏中找到"Terminal"选项,并点击打开终端。
3. 在终端中输入以下命令来安装drf:
```
pip install djangorestframework
```
4. 等待安装完成。一旦安装完成,你将看到类似以下内容的输出:
```
Successfully installed djangorestframework-x.x.x
```
现在,你已经成功使用pip在PyCharm中安装了Django REST Framework(drf)!
相关问题
PyCharm 怎么安装依赖
### 如何在 PyCharm 中安装项目依赖
#### 配置 Python 解释器
在 PyCharm 的标题栏中,可以通过 `File → Settings → Project: → Python Interpreter` 来配置项目的解释器以及管理依赖项[^1]。
#### 创建虚拟环境并安装依赖
如果需要新创建一个虚拟环境来安装所有的依赖项,则可以按照以下方式操作:
- 使用命令生成当前环境中已安装的包列表到文件 `requirements.txt`:
```bash
pip freeze > requirements.txt
```
这一步会记录下当前环境下所有使用的库及其版本号[^2]。
- 如果要基于现有的 `requirements.txt` 文件安装所需的全部依赖,可以在终端运行如下指令完成批量部署:
```bash
pip install -r requirements.txt
```
#### 更换国内镜像源加速下载速度
为了提高软件包获取效率,建议更换成清华大学开源软件镜像站作为默认索引地址。执行下面这条语句即可实现全局设置更改:
```bash
pip config set global.index-url https://pypi.tuna.tsinghua.edu.cn/simple
```
此方法能够有效减少因网络原因造成的失败情况发生概率。
#### 单独添加新的依赖
当需求文档中的 dependencies 列表发生变化时,比如新增了一个名为 `drf-yasg==1.20.0` 的第三方扩展工具支持 API 文档自动生成功能模块,那么只需要单独对其进行指定位置下的手动加载处理就可以了:
```bash
pip install drf-yasg==1.20.0 --target D:\workspace\coding\GreaterWMS\venv\Lib\site-packages
```
这里需要注意的是路径参数应指向实际存在的 site-packages 路径下才能生效[^3]。
通过上述几种途径之一便能顺利完成整个流程当中关于 python packages management 方面的工作内容啦!
在pycharm中下载drissionpage包
在PyCharm中下载DrissionPage包(假设你是指Django Rest Swagger页面生成工具),需要按照以下步骤操作:
1. 打开PyCharm,确保已安装了Python解释器和pip(Python包管理器)。
2. 如果还没有安装Django和其相关的Swagger插件如djangorestframework-swagger,首先通过命令行或者PyCharm的终端(Terminal或Conda Prompt)运行:
```
pip install django djangorestframework-drf-yasg
```
这会安装Django REST框架及其YASG(Yet Another Swagger UI)插件。
3. 接下来,要在项目中添加DrissionPage的支持,你需要安装djangorestframework-docs,它提供了更美观的文档页面:
```
pip install djangorestframework-docs
```
4. 在你的项目的settings.py文件中,配置`INSTALLED_APPS`列表包含'djangorestframework', 'djangorestframework_swagger', 和'djangorestframework_docs'。
5. 确保在`REST_FRAMEWORK`部分包含了相应的Swagger设置,例如:
```python
REST_FRAMEWORK = {
'DEFAULT_SCHEMA_CLASS': 'rest_framework.schemas.coreapi.AutoSchema',
# 其他配置...
}
SWAGGER_SETTINGS = {
# 配置Swaggaer的具体选项
}
DOC_PATH = 'api/docs/'
```
6. 创建视图和API,使用`@api_view()`装饰器标记为公开API,并使用`schema=AutoSchema()`指定自动生成的文档。
7. 最后,在项目的urls.py中,将`docs` URL指向`django.contrib.staticfiles.urls`以便访问文档页面。
完成上述步骤后,你应该可以在PyCharm的内置浏览器中查看生成的DrissionPage风格的API文档了。如果遇到问题,可以尝试更新PyCharm到最新版本,或者查阅相关文档寻求帮助。
阅读全文
相关推荐
















